Professional Dealers Who Know How to Engage
The dealers are the heartbeat of a casino night. They are the ones interacting with every guest at their table, managing the pace of the game, teaching new players, celebrating wins, and keeping the energy alive throughout the evening. A great dealer is part game expert, part entertainer, and part host.
At Ace High Casino, every dealer is professionally trained and deeply experienced in the games they run. They can read a table — knowing when to speed up the action for a competitive group and when to slow down and teach for a crowd of first-timers. They treat every player with patience and enthusiasm, making sure no one ever feels out of place or intimidated.
When dealers are engaged and professional, guests stay at the table longer, have more fun, and walk away with a much better impression of the event as a whole. When dealers are underprepared or disengaged, the entire experience suffers — regardless of how nice the venue is.

The Right Game Mix for Your Audience
A casino night built entirely around high-skill games can alienate first-time players. One built only around simple games can bore experienced ones. The right game selection balances accessibility with excitement, giving every guest something that feels both approachable and engaging.
Ace High offers an extensive game inventory — from classic blackjack, roulette, and Texas Hold’em to specialty games like Pai Gow Poker, Baccarat, Ace Dice, Horse Racing, and more. Our team helps you select the combination that matches your group’s size, demographics, and energy, so every guest finds a table they love.
A Prize Structure That Creates Genuine Excitement
Prizes give casino chips real meaning and transform casual play into something guests genuinely invest in throughout the evening. The anticipation of the prize ceremony sustains engagement from the first hand to the final call — and a well-designed prize structure ensures that multiple guests win, making the close of the night inclusive, exciting, and memorable for everyone in the room. At Ace High Casino, we offer three distinct ways to structure your prize distribution, each with its own energy and advantages.
Option 1: Raffle Tickets
Numbers Are Called The raffle ticket format is the most classic and universally recognized prize structure, and it works beautifully at casino nights because it directly rewards guests for their time at the tables. At the end of gaming, guests exchange their chips for raffle tickets at a set rate — typically 1,000 chips per ticket — and place half their tickets into the prize drawing pool. The more a guest plays throughout the evening, the more chips they accumulate, and the more tickets they have in the pot. When the prize drawing begins, ticket numbers are called one at a time and the winning guest claims their prize. This format creates sustained anticipation throughout the ceremony — every ticket called that is not yours raises the odds that the next one will be. The energy in the room builds with each drawing, and the format gives every guest a genuine, tangible shot at winning regardless of their skill level at the tables. It is fair, transparent, and thrilling to watch unfold.
Option 2: Drawing Slips
Names Are Called The drawing slip format replaces ticket numbers with guests’ names written on entry slips, which are placed into a drawing bowl or drum at the start of the event or throughout the evening. Instead of a number being called, a name is announced — which creates an immediate, personal reaction that the whole room responds to. This format is particularly effective at smaller or mid-sized events where most guests know each other. Hearing a colleague’s name called produces a collective reaction — cheers, laughter, good-natured groans — that turns the prize ceremony into a genuinely communal moment. Drawing slips can also be structured so that guests earn additional entries through gameplay, rewarding active participants just as the raffle ticket format does. Our Masters of Ceremonies handle the drawing with energy and personality, making each name called feel like its own event.
Option 3: IOUs
Auctioned Off with a Master of Ceremonies The IOU format is our most dynamic and high-energy prize structure, and it creates a finale unlike anything else. At the end of gaming, each guest’s chip total is tallied and written on a personal IOU — a slip of paper bearing their name and their total chip count. These IOUs become bidding currency. Our Master of Ceremonies then runs a live auction, presenting each prize one at a time and inviting guests to bid using their IOU values. The guest with the highest chip total has the most bidding power, directly rewarding the best players of the evening. But the auction format introduces strategy and drama that pure luck-based drawings do not: guests must decide which prizes to bid on, how aggressively to bid, and whether to hold their chips in reserve for something better coming up. A skilled Master of Ceremonies builds tension between bids, encourages competitive bidding, and turns the prize ceremony into the most entertaining thirty minutes of the night. The IOU auction is ideal for groups that love competition and want their best players rewarded. It extends the competitive spirit of the casino floor all the way to the last prize — and it gives guests who spent the evening building a big chip stack a moment of genuine payoff.
